Transaction 63a249e9084d2c5a86b1ab004a20a7934fe3e5d83df7b9b5dc91022916cce643

13 Input
1 Outputs
  • 63a249e9084d2c5a86b1ab004a20a7934fe3e5d83df7b9b5dc91022916cce643:0
  • value  17588451
    address  37o8QZRTmz2jbfUqGVMveK6kSaVYUsiv8e